• 25-04-2021, 22:39:49
    #1
    Merhabalar,

    Websiteme sosyal medya üzerinden anlık trafik çekmekteyim. İlgi çekici haberler olduğu zaman anlık 500-1000 arası hite kadar çıkabiliyor. VPS- Hosting önderisi için konu açtığımda güzel hostingden Premium - D paketinin sorun yaratmayacağı konusunda teklif geldi ve siparişi verip sunucumu taşıdım.

    Siteye anlık 200+ hit geldiği zaman Captcha sorgusu geliyor ve gelen captcha hiç bir şekilde geçilmiyor ( Çözdükten sonra captcha ekranı sayfa yeniliyor sürekli ve ilgili içeriğe girmiyor ) Bu sorun için yaklaşık 20 ticket attım fakat, captcha kodu saldırıdıdan koruyor daha iyi, Cloud flar geçince sorun düzeleri ( geçtik fakat düzelmedi ) gibi cevaplar geliyor ve sürekli bu sorunu yaşıyorum. Bu yüzden sosyal medyada binlerce takipçi kaybettim.

    Net olarak bu sorunun çözülmesini ya da bir şey söylenmesini istiyorum artık.

  • 26-04-2021, 00:26:39
    #2
    @Bartuc; @GuzelNetTr; etiketleyelim baksınlar.
  • 26-04-2021, 11:59:23
    #3
    Kurumsal PLUS
    Merhabalar,

    Öncelikle yaşadığınız sorundan ötürü üzgünüz.

    Buradaki sorunun Captcha ile ilgisi bulunmamaktadır. Yani Captcha çıkmıyor olsa bile site yine açılmayacaktır. Çünkü zaten sizin de belirttiğiniz üzere anlık 500-1000 hit diyorsunuz, bunlar anlık olduğu zaman ve her siteye giren ziyaretçi bir CPU kullanımı yaptığı zaman, 4-core olan CPU limitiniz bile yetersiz kalmaktadır. cPanel'inizdeki Kaynak Kullanımı bölümünden bunu takip edebilirsiniz. Dolayısıyla sorununuz Captcha değil, anlık olarak çok fazla hit çekiyor olmanızdır. Bunu yapacağınız zaman hit çekeceğiniz sayfaları statik hale getirip herhangi bir PHP/MySQL sorgusu çalışmayacak şekilde düzenlemenizi önerebiliriz, bu şekilde bir çözüm bulabilirsiniz. Bu hizmetin yerine ister VPS, ister kiralık sunucu vb. ne kullanırsanız kullanın çözüm olmayacaktır, anlık hit alındığında sorun olmasın istiyorsanız ilgili sayfada minimum sorgu olması ya da hiç olmaması gereklidir. Hit alınacak sayfa statik yapılarak bu durum çözülebilir.

    Captcha ise bir saldırı koruma önlemidir. Sitenize bir anda yoğun bir hit geldiği zaman bu sayfa görünür. Eğer bu bir saldırı ise ve Captcha ile engellendiyse zaten bu ekrandan sonra siteniz açılır, çoğu durumda son derce etkili bir saldırı koruması sağlanmaktadır. Ancak buradaki sorun sitenize girenlerin saldırı vb. bot değil, gerçek ziyaretçi olması. Ziyaretçilerin tamamı captcha'dan geçiyor ama CPU limitiniz dolduğu için siteye erişemiyor.

    CPU kullanımınızla ilgili olarak hosting hizmeti taraflı yapılabilecek bir işlem ne yazık ki yoktur, Litespeed cache ve memcached kullanım imkanı sunuyoruz, gerisi tamamen yazılımınızda bitiyor. Yukarıda da belirttiğim gibi hit alınacak sayfayı statik yaparak bu sorunu kolayca aşabilirsiniz, anlık çok hit gelince Captcha görünse bile statik sayfa CPU kullanımı yapmayacağı için site hemen sorunsuz şekilde açılacaktır.

    Belirttiğim gibi yaşadığınız sorundan ötürü üzgünüz, şikayet "captcha geçilememesi" ve "captcha" odaklı olduğu için bu noktaeda anlaşmazlık olmuş gibi görünmektedir. Sizin yaşadığınız sorun Captcha ile hiçbir şekilde bağlantılı değildir, belirttiğim gibi captcha açılmıyor olsa da site yine yüksek CPU kullanımından ötürü açılmayacaktır. Yani sorun anlık hit kaynaklı yüksek CPU kullanımıdır. Destek üzerinde de sürekli captcha üzerinde konuşulduğu için karışıklık olmuştur.
  • 26-04-2021, 14:25:29
    #4
    Bartuc adlı üyeden alıntı: mesajı görüntüle
    Merhabalar,

    Öncelikle yaşadığınız sorundan ötürü üzgünüz.

    Buradaki sorunun Captcha ile ilgisi bulunmamaktadır. Yani Captcha çıkmıyor olsa bile site yine açılmayacaktır. Çünkü zaten sizin de belirttiğiniz üzere anlık 500-1000 hit diyorsunuz, bunlar anlık olduğu zaman ve her siteye giren ziyaretçi bir CPU kullanımı yaptığı zaman, 4-core olan CPU limitiniz bile yetersiz kalmaktadır. cPanel'inizdeki Kaynak Kullanımı bölümünden bunu takip edebilirsiniz. Dolayısıyla sorununuz Captcha değil, anlık olarak çok fazla hit çekiyor olmanızdır. Bunu yapacağınız zaman hit çekeceğiniz sayfaları statik hale getirip herhangi bir PHP/MySQL sorgusu çalışmayacak şekilde düzenlemenizi önerebiliriz, bu şekilde bir çözüm bulabilirsiniz. Bu hizmetin yerine ister VPS, ister kiralık sunucu vb. ne kullanırsanız kullanın çözüm olmayacaktır, anlık hit alındığında sorun olmasın istiyorsanız ilgili sayfada minimum sorgu olması ya da hiç olmaması gereklidir. Hit alınacak sayfa statik yapılarak bu durum çözülebilir.

    Captcha ise bir saldırı koruma önlemidir. Sitenize bir anda yoğun bir hit geldiği zaman bu sayfa görünür. Eğer bu bir saldırı ise ve Captcha ile engellendiyse zaten bu ekrandan sonra siteniz açılır, çoğu durumda son derce etkili bir saldırı koruması sağlanmaktadır. Ancak buradaki sorun sitenize girenlerin saldırı vb. bot değil, gerçek ziyaretçi olması. Ziyaretçilerin tamamı captcha'dan geçiyor ama CPU limitiniz dolduğu için siteye erişemiyor.

    CPU kullanımınızla ilgili olarak hosting hizmeti taraflı yapılabilecek bir işlem ne yazık ki yoktur, Litespeed cache ve memcached kullanım imkanı sunuyoruz, gerisi tamamen yazılımınızda bitiyor. Yukarıda da belirttiğim gibi hit alınacak sayfayı statik yaparak bu sorunu kolayca aşabilirsiniz, anlık çok hit gelince Captcha görünse bile statik sayfa CPU kullanımı yapmayacağı için site hemen sorunsuz şekilde açılacaktır.

    Belirttiğim gibi yaşadığınız sorundan ötürü üzgünüz, şikayet "captcha geçilememesi" ve "captcha" odaklı olduğu için bu noktaeda anlaşmazlık olmuş gibi görünmektedir. Sizin yaşadığınız sorun Captcha ile hiçbir şekilde bağlantılı değildir, belirttiğim gibi captcha açılmıyor olsa da site yine yüksek CPU kullanımından ötürü açılmayacaktır. Yani sorun anlık hit kaynaklı yüksek CPU kullanımıdır. Destek üzerinde de sürekli captcha üzerinde konuşulduğu için karışıklık olmuştur.

    Merhabalar,

    İlginiz için teşekkürler fakat durumu izah ettiğimde şu an kullandığım paket r10 üzerinden sizin tarafınızdan sorun yaşatmaz diyerek önerildi.

    Anlamadığım nokta işe şu, paket yükseltmenin de çözüm olmayacağını söylemişsiniz fakat anlık 10k 20k hatta 50k hiti olan siteler her sayfalarını statik mi yapıyorlar.
  • 26-04-2021, 14:33:53
    #5
    Kurumsal PLUS
    Grapya adlı üyeden alıntı: mesajı görüntüle
    Merhabalar,

    İlginiz için teşekkürler fakat durumu izah ettiğimde şu an kullandığım paket r10 üzerinden sizin tarafınızdan sorun yaşatmaz diyerek önerildi.

    Anlamadığım nokta işe şu, paket yükseltmenin de çözüm olmayacağını söylemişsiniz fakat anlık 10k 20k hatta 50k hiti olan siteler her sayfalarını statik mi yapıyorlar.
    Bizim bu şekilde bir garanti verebilmemiz mümkün değil, yani bizim vereceğimiz garanti sadece yazılım iyi optimize edilmiş ise şeklinde olabilir. Asla hit garantisi vermeyiz. Çünkü kimi yazılımda 1-2 ziyaretçiyle bile CPU limiti dolarken kimi anlık binlerce ziyaretçi ile tamamen sorunsuz çalışıyor. Bu yüzden bir garanti vermek ya da hit garantisi vermek mümkün olmuyor.

    Belirttiğiniz gibi bu tip anlık çok yoğun hit alan siteler ya çok iyi bir cache kullanıp hiçbir sorgu çalışmadan sayfanın görüntülenmesini sağlıyorlar, ya da statik sayfa yaparak bunu sağlıyorlar. Başka türlü mümkün değil, farzedelim ki her bir ziyarette sistem %30 CPU kullanıyor(ki özellikle wordpress ile tema/eklentiye bağlı olarak %200'lere varan yani tek işlemin 2-core cpu kullandığını gördüğümüz durumlar olabiliyor), anlık 10 kişi girdiğinde %300 yani 3-core cpu yapar. Anlık 100 kişi giriyorsa %3000 yani 30-core cpu yapar. Böyle düşünüğünüzde binlerce TL'lik bir kiralık sunucunun bile bu işi çözemeyeceğini anlayabilirsiniz. Dolayısıyla anlık yoğun hit konusu tamamen yazılımın sorgu çalıştırmıyor olması sayesinde karşılanabilir olacaktır.